Storyline
Plot Summary |
Four best friends start high school. Each one is unique and likes their own thing; Chloe joins the soccer team, Sasha joins the cheer leading squad, Jade is part of the math club. While the other girls hang out with their chosen crowds, Yasmin is left all alone. When Meredith, the most popular girl, sees this she automatically knows they are trouble. After years of not talking to each other Jade and Yasmin speak a few words in the restroom but Yasmin doesn't have the courage to tell Jade she misses her. The four girls are reunited when they are sent to detention for causing a food fight. The reunited foursome find out they are not invited to a huge party given by Meredith. Worse, Chloe finds out that her mom has a job serving food at the party. They are forced to work for Meredith. At the party, Meredith decides to expose Yasmin's secret (her dancing and singing with a face mask.) When Yasmin's brother starts doing a dance and everybody joins in, Meredith is humiliated. When Meredith accidentally gets thrown into the pool she calls the four best friends "bratz." The girls decide to be part of the talent show to win a scholarship. Meredith is always the one who wins, yet the "bratz" are prepared to take her down. Meredith renews her threats to Yasmin; if she continues preparing for the show, Meredith will expose her friend's secrets. Yasmin decides to call everything off. In the end, the girls do the talent show, and boldly tell everybody their secrets which turn out not to be so bad after all. The girls win and each end up with their respective crushes. The girls decide to give Chloe the scholarship. The movie ends with the girls walking down a red carpet. Written by cely |

Trivia | Paula Abdul was originally hired as the film's Executive Producer, Fashion Designer, and Dance Choreographer. During an episode of Hey Paula (2007), she received an e-mail on her Blackberry firing her from this movie. See more » |
Goofs | Dylan is deaf, so he couldn't have known what to dance to at Meredith's Sweet 16 when she previewed Yasmin dancing "La Cucaracha". However, Dylan can lip read. From the dance Yasmin was doing in the video, it's not hard to guess what song it was. See more » |
